Lógica e Algoritmo.........Esses sao os termos mais ouvidos quando se entra no mundo da programacao....
Sen duvida este é o principio da programação
Programar é lógica, convertida em passos praticos. Imaginem voces que para nós tomar banho (isso pra quem toma claro!! hehehe) utilizamos lógica e convertemos em passos como:
-Pegar a Bacia ou Balde (pra nós pobres)
-Abrir a torneira
-Encher o balde ou bacia com agua
-Preparar o sabão ou sabonte
-depois vem a parte mais complexa que varia de pessoa em pessoa, por isso nem vou me atrevir em descrever.
Há essa sequencia de passos chamamos Algoritmo. Algoritmo é nada mais nada menos que uma sequencia de passos destinados a resolução de um determindo problema, no nosso caso acima o problema é "TOMAR BANHO"(podem crer que esse é um problema pra muita gente, hehehe
)
Voltando ao que importa, pois o que foi visto acima é apenas uma ideia do que poderás encontrar quando chegares ao fundo da Lógica e Algoritmia.
Muitos devem estar a se perguntar, se é assim que colocaremos no computador e ja esta...Claro que nao, até porque da maneira que descrevemos o algoritmo ai encima é so uma das varias maneiras de representar algoritmos.
Podemos descrever os algoritmos em 3 formas que sao:
--DESCRIÇÃO NARRATIVA (está é a forma que usamos pra descrever o problema acima)
--FLUXOGRAMA
--PSEUDOCÓDICO OU LINGUAGEM ALGORTMICA
É comum encontrarmos outras palavras pra descrever estas 3 formas, mas concerteza nao fogem muito das citadas. Entre as 3 desctacam-se duas como mais importantes que são FLUXOGRAMA E PSEUDOCODIGO, visto que quem sabe o PSEUDOCODIGO facilemente usa a DESCRIÇÃO NARRATIVA.
Mas qual das duas é realmente necessária pra o nosso objectivo(programar)???
Posso vos garantir que as duas sao necessarias, mas a PSEUDOCODIGO destaca-se, visto que as linguagens de programação se assemelham mais a ela. Mas isso nao quer dizer que nao devemos estudar as demais formas, apenas devemos dar uma atencao especial na PSEUDOCODIGO. percebem???
Para mais aconselho apostilas de Logica de Programação e Algoritmos(Algoritimia)...................
Eu tenho algumas, quem quiser é so deixar seu E-MAIL que eu depois mando....PODEM ENCONTRAR MAIS APOSTILAS NOS SEGUINTES LINKS
***Mais de 20 apostilas de Lógica->http://apostilando.com/sessao.php?cod=29
**Apostila de Lógica completa->http://bitsfacil.blogspot.com/2008/04/apostila-de-lgica-de-progrmao-para-quem.html
***Aqui tem muita coisa interessante sobre logica->http://www.plugmasters.com.br/downloads/categoria/379/Banco-de-Apostilas/L%C3%B3gica-de-Programa%C3%A7%C3%A3o
bons estudos ai...............